Choosing the Right Cordless Combo Kit: Your Essential Buying Guide

Cordless combo kits are fantastic tools. They give you several power tools in one neat package. This guide helps you pick the best one for your needs, whether you are a weekend DIYer or a serious professional.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for a combo kit, several features truly matter. Think about what you will use the tools for most often.

  • **Tool Variety:** Most kits include a drill/driver and an impact driver. Better kits add a circular saw, reciprocating saw (Sawzall), or an oscillating multi-tool. Decide which extra tools you need.
  • **Battery Platform & Voltage (V):** Batteries are the heart of cordless tools. Look for 18V or 20V systems; these are standard and powerful. Ensure the brand uses a battery system you like. You can often use one battery across many tools from the same brand.
  • **Motor Type:** Brushless motors are better than brushed motors. Brushless motors last longer, use less battery power, and offer more power. They are worth the extra cost.
  • **Speed Settings & Torque:** A drill needs variable speed control. High torque (twisting power) is important for driving big screws or drilling tough materials.
Important Materials and Build Quality

The materials used determine how long your tools last. Good construction resists drops and tough job site conditions.

Tool housings should use strong, durable plastic, often reinforced with fiberglass. Metal components, especially in the chuck (the part that holds the bit) on the drill, offer much better reliability than plastic ones. Check the gearbox casing; metal casings handle heat and stress better than plastic ones.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Quality isn’t just about brand names. Specific design choices make a huge difference in performance.

Factors that Improve Quality:
  • **Overload Protection:** This feature stops the tool from overheating when you push it too hard. It saves the motor’s life.
  • **LED Work Lights:** A bright light built into the tool helps you see clearly in dark corners.
  • **Ergonomics:** Comfortable grips reduce hand fatigue, especially during long projects.
Factors that Reduce Quality:
  • **Cheap Plastic Gearing:** If the internal gears are plastic instead of metal, they break easily under heavy load.
  • **Slow Charging Time:** If the battery charger takes many hours, you spend too much time waiting around. Look for fast chargers.
  • **Proprietary Batteries:** If the batteries only fit one specific tool model, you lose flexibility.
User Experience and Common Use Cases

Think about where you will use these tools. This affects how much power you need.

For basic home repairs, like hanging shelves or assembling furniture, a standard 18V kit with a drill and impact driver works perfectly. The impact driver makes driving long screws simple and fast.

If you plan to do heavy demolition or frequent cutting, you need a more robust kit. A reciprocating saw is great for cutting wood or metal pipes in tight spots. A circular saw lets you tackle deck building or framing projects. Always test the balance of the tools; a well-balanced tool feels lighter and is safer to use overhead.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Cordless Combo Kits

Q: What is the main difference between a drill and an impact driver?

A: A drill spins to make holes or drive screws. An impact driver adds a hammering action (rotational impacts) when it meets resistance. This makes driving long, tough screws much easier without tiring your wrist.

Q: Should I buy a kit with two batteries or three?

A: Two batteries are usually enough for most homeowners. One battery works while the other charges. If you work all day on big projects, get three batteries so you never have downtime.

Q: Are brushless motors really worth the extra money?

A: Yes. Brushless motors use electricity more efficiently. This means you get longer run times from the same battery. They also run cooler and last longer than older brushed motors.

Q: What does “Kit” mean in this context?

A: “Kit” means you buy several tools together, usually including batteries and a charger, all packed in a carrying case. It is usually cheaper than buying each item separately.

Q: How long should a good battery last on a charge?

A: This depends on the battery’s Amp-hour (Ah) rating and what you are doing. A 4.0Ah battery used for light drilling might last hours. Driving heavy lag bolts will drain it much faster.

Q: Can I use batteries from a different brand in these tools?

A: No. Battery shapes and connections are specific to each brand (like DeWalt, Milwaukee, Ryobi). You must use the batteries made for that specific tool line.

Q: What is the most important tool to have in a basic combo kit?

A: The drill/driver is the most essential tool. Almost every project needs drilling holes or driving screws, so make sure the drill in the kit feels good in your hand.

Q: If I buy a cheaper kit, what quality parts am I likely sacrificing?

A: You often sacrifice motor quality (getting a brushed motor instead of brushless) and durability in the housing and chucks. Cheaper kits might also use slower chargers.

Q: Are these tools too heavy for an average person to use?

A: Modern cordless tools are designed to be balanced. However, always check the weight if you have wrist or shoulder issues. Lithium-ion batteries are much lighter than older battery types.

Q: What should I look for in the carrying case?

A: The case should be tough plastic or aluminum. It needs strong latches and custom cutouts so the tools, batteries, and charger stay secure during transport.
